2026-08-31

Chinese President Xi held talks with Kyrgyz President Sadyr Japarov in Bishkek on Aug. 31. Xi urged implementation of the governments’ economic and trade cooperation plan, expanding trade categories and developing digital trade and cross-border e-commerce. He called for high‑quality construction of the China‑Kyrgyzstan‑Uzbekistan railway and modernization of border ports, and deeper alignment of institutions, standards and rules to boost connectivity. Xi pushed for more flagship projects in renewable energy and resource recycling, implementation of a green‑minerals cooperation document, and full supply‑chain collaboration. He also proposed a Belt and Road joint laboratory and stepped‑up AI and technology cooperation, and sought increased people‑to‑people exchanges across youth, media, tourism, sports, medical and local channels.
